Kusaba X is an open-source imageboard software written in PHP. It is designed to be fast, simple, and customizable for managing online communities focused on image sharing.

Project Mitsuba is a research-oriented open source renderer that focuses on the development of new rendering algorithms by providing a common software framework. It aims to facilitate research in rendering algorithms, light transport simulation, and virtual prototyping.
